Post Job Free
Sign in

IT Developer Analyst Assistant

Company:
NABA
Location:
Milan, Italy
Posted:
October 13, 2025
Apply

Description:

Join NABA

We are the largest private Academy in Italy, and the first recognized by the Italian Ministry of Education, University and Research (MIUR) back in 1980. As a leading institution in arts and design education, we offer degrees in design, fashion, communication, multimedia arts, set design, and visual arts. We are now looking for a new talent to join our IT team:

Junior IT Developer Analyst

Are you at the beginning of your career and eager to grow in a dynamic, creative, and academic settingwhere learning never stops? At NABA, you'll have the opportunity to work across both infrastructure and application domains, supporting users and developing real, impactful digital solutions.

This hybrid role is perfect for someonewho enjoys switching between writing code and solvingpractical IT issues in the field. You'll collaborate closely with experienced professionals, explore the latest technologies, and grow by turning everyday challenges into user-centric innovations.

If you're willing to learn and want to make a difference from day one — we want to meet you

Key Responsibilities:

Application Analysis & Development

Support the collection and documentation of functional and technical requirements by working closely with business and technical stakeholders.

Translate business needs into clear, structured technical documentation

Assist in the development and maintenance of basic software components (frontend/backend), following team guidance.

Contribute to the design and modeling of IT processes and application workflows

Participate in testing and support quality assurance activities

Document technical solutions and contribute to user manuals or support documentation

Academic IT Support & Field Interaction

Provide technical support to faculty, students, and staff for devices and applications (e.g., PCs, projectors, printers, BlackBoard, O365, etc.).

Interact directly with users to understand their needs, identify recurring issues or in efficiencies, and help design more effective, user-centered solutions

Help transform support cases into opportunities for improvements through automation or smarter system configurations

Aid in setting up and maintaining classrooms and labs

Qualifications:

Degree or technical diploma in Computer Science, Engineering, Mathematics, or related field.

Basic programming knowledge in JavaScript and/or Python.

Familiarity with at least one development framework: (.NET, Angular or React – even via university/personal projects)

Basic understanding of relational or NoSQL databases

Interest in Agile methodologies and understanding of the CI/CD development life cycle

Strong analytical and problem-solving attitude

Excellent communication and interpersonal skills: you enjoy talking to people and finding solutions together

Proactive mindset with a strong desire to learn by doing

Bonus skills (not mandatory but nice to have): Knowledge of Azure DevOpsor different similar tools

According to the GDPR 679/16 we inform you that the treatment of Personal Data contained in your resume, will respect the principles of legality, fairness and transparency and protection of your privacy and your rights. We only use the personal data we collect for the recruiting activities, such as your name, surname, address, email address, educational and employment background and job qualifications.

skills

R-24183

Apply